It's probably my favourite M83 album, with Before The Dawn Heals Us not too far behind in second place. I have a lot of memories attached to this album and for me it's one of those albums that transports you back to a certain time and place. It transports me back to around this time 2 years ago and the memories associated with that period.
One thing I really love about the album is the almost seamless collision of electronics and live instrumentation, and the dreamy shoegazey textures blending it all together. The songs themselves are very memorable and have a certain bittersweet feel to them.
I think the album flows very nicely, as if it's one piece of music with each individual song forming a movement in this musical journey. As regards 'Midnight Souls Still Remain' (the droning 11-minute repetitive track at the very end) I presume it's meant to cause some kind of hypnotic, meditative, trance-like effect on the listener but I very rarely listen to the whole track. I'll usually listen to it for about 5 minutes and then get bored and hit stop. But overall it's great album.
